What Is a Crypto Casino?
A crypto casino is an online gaming site that accepts cryptocurrency-- such as Bitcoin, Ethereum, Litecoin, or stablecoins-- as a main form of payment. Unlike conventional online casinos that depend on fiat currencies and central payment processors, a crypto casino leverages blockchain technology to assist in deposits, wagers, and withdrawals. Many of these platforms also host games whose results are verifiable on the blockchain, including a layer of transparency that standard operators frequently lack.
How a Crypto Casino WorksAccount Creation-- Players register by generating a username and password, typically without any personal information required (a practice referred to as "KYC‑free" registration). Wallet Integration-- The platform offers an unique wallet address or incorporates with external crypto wallets (e.g., MetaMask). Gamers transfer funds from their personal wallet to the casino's hot or cold wallet. Bet Placement-- Games are used in two primary formats: Provably Fair Games-- Cryptographic algorithms let gamers validate each hand or spin's fairness. Timeless RNG Games-- Standard random number generators are utilized, however the platform still settling in crypto.Payments-- Winnings are credited to the player's on‑site wallet and can be withdrawn straight to a blockchain address. Security and Fairness2-element authentication (2FA)-- Most trustworthy Crypto Casino's gambling establishments need 2FA for withdrawals. Cold Storage-- Funds are kept in offline cold wallets to alleviate hacking threat. Provably Fair Algorithms-- Players can verify game hashes utilizing publicly readily available tools. Third‑Party Audits-- Independent testing companies (e.g., eCOGRA, iTech Labs) routinely audit RNGs and payout percentages.Future Outlook
